当前位置: 技术问答>java相关
JBuilder中用MYSQL数据库,用中文进行条件查询时,查不出任和数据?
来源: 互联网 发布时间:2015-01-29
本文导语: | 不知你用的使什么jdbc,jdbc驱动应该有encoding的设置的 设置成gb2312吧 | 你的sql语句中的where条件中有关中文的问题,需要进行转码,一般用 String text=request.getParameter("text") text=new String(text.getBytes(...
|
不知你用的使什么jdbc,jdbc驱动应该有encoding的设置的
设置成gb2312吧
设置成gb2312吧
|
你的sql语句中的where条件中有关中文的问题,需要进行转码,一般用
String text=request.getParameter("text")
text=new String(text.getBytes("ISO8859_1"),"GBK");
select="select * from text where text="+text;
String text=request.getParameter("text")
text=new String(text.getBytes("ISO8859_1"),"GBK");
select="select * from text where text="+text;
|
我觉得2.06的mm驱动有中文的问题,偶还是觉得1.0x的好
|
我也曾在3.0版遇到这个问题,转换不能实现正确查询,但使用4.0就迎刃而解了